Here is another definition of a blizzard. This is a direct quote from an article on Texas A&M's online newspaper tamutimes.tamu.edu
“In meteorological terms, a blizzard is a severe storm that has below freezing temperatures, winds of at least 35 miles per hour and heavy snowfall, with visibility reduced to no less than one-fourth of a mile,” he explains. “All of these conditions have to last at least three hours. So just a heavy snowfall is not always a blizzard."
